Middle East Tensions: Impact on Regional Dynamics
The conflict in the Middle East is spreading to Lebanon, creating severe implications for the region, according to the Kremlin. The statement came from spokesman Dmitry Peskov amid speculations about Israel potentially planning a military operation in Syria, an ally of Russia.

The Kremlin has expressed concern over the widening conflict in the Middle East, which now affects Lebanon.
On Thursday,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ov commented that this escalation is having catastrophic effects on regional stability. He addressed these concerns during a press briefing.
The discussion arose in light of reports suggesting Israel might engage in military action against Syria, a nation considered a close ally of Russia.
